Two tiger cub brothers are town from the jungle and taken to Rome.

The stronger cub is trained as a killer at the Coliseum.

Emperor Caesar makes a gift of the smaller cub to his beautiful daughter, Aurelia.

She adores her cub, Boots, and Julius, a young animal keeper, teaches her how to earn the tiger's trust.

Boots is pampered while his brother, known as Brute, lives in a cold and dark cage, let out only to kill.

Caesar trusts Julius to watch Aurelia and her prized pet.

But when a prank backfires, Boots temporarily escapes and Julius must pay with his life.

Thousands watch as Julius is sent unarmed into the arena to face the killer Brute.
